參數(shù)資料
型號: XE8807AMI026TLF
廠商: Semtech
文件頁數(shù): 54/143頁
文件大?。?/td> 0K
描述: IC MCU LOW PWR MTP FLASH 32-TQFP
標(biāo)準(zhǔn)包裝: 1
系列: XE880x
應(yīng)用: 感測機(jī)
核心處理器: Coolrisc816?
程序存儲器類型: 閃存(11 kB)
控制器系列: XE8000
RAM 容量: 512 x 8
接口: UART,USRT
輸入/輸出數(shù): 24
電源電壓: 2.4 V ~ 5.5 V
工作溫度: -40°C ~ 85°C
安裝類型: 表面貼裝
封裝/外殼: 32-TQFP
包裝: 標(biāo)準(zhǔn)包裝
供應(yīng)商設(shè)備封裝: 32-TQFP(7x7)
產(chǎn)品目錄頁面: 585 (CN2011-ZH PDF)
配用: XE8000MP-ND - PROG BOARD AND PROSTART2 CARD
其它名稱: XE8807AMI026DKR
Semtech 2006
www.semtech.com
3-2
XE8806A/XE8807A
3.1
CPU description
The CPU of the XE8000 series is a low power RISC core. It has 16 internal registers for efficient implementation of
the C compiler. Its instruction set is made up of 35 generic instructions, all coded on 22 bits, with 8 addressing
modes. All instructions are executed in one clock cycle, including conditional jumps and 8x8 multiplication. The
circuit therefore runs on 1 MIPS on a 1MHz clock.
The CPU hardware and software description is given in the document “Coolrisc816 Hardware and Software
Reference Manual”. A short summary is given in the following paragraphs.
The
good
code
efficiency
of
the
CPU
core
makes
it
possible
to
compute
a
polynomial
like
Y
B
X
Y
A
Z
+
+
=
1
0
1
0
)
(
in less than 300 clock cycles (software code generated by the XEMICS C-
compiler, all numbers are signed integers on 16 bits).
3.2
CPU internal registers
As shown in Figure 3-1, the CPU has 16 internal 8-bit registers. Some of these registers can be concatenated to a
16-bit word for use in some instructions. The function of these registers is defined in Table 3-1. The status register
stat (Table 3-2) is used to manage the different interrupt and event levels. An interrupt or an event can both be
used to wake up after a HALT instruction. The difference is that an interrupt jumps to a special interrupt function
whereas an event continues the software execution with the instruction following the HALT instruction.
The program counter (PC) is a 16 bit register that indicates the address of the instruction that has to be executed.
The stack (STn) is used to memorise the return address when executing subroutines or interrupt routines.
Instruction
memory
22bit
CPU
in
tern
al
r
egister
s
a
stat
iph
ipl
i3h
i3l
i2h
i2l
i1h
i1l
i0h
i0l
r3
r2
r1
r0
Data memory
da
ta
b
us
in
stru
ction
b
u
s
PC
ST
1
ST
2
ST
3
ST
4
program counter stack
Figure 3-1. CPU internal registers
相關(guān)PDF資料
PDF描述
XIO2200AGGW IC PCI-EXPRESS/BUS BRIDGE 176BGA
XIO2200AZGW IC PCI-EXPRESS/BUS BRIDGE 176BGA
XPC823ZT81B2T IC MPU POWERQUICC 81MHZ 256-PBGA
XPC8240RZU250E MCU HOST PROCESSOR 352-TBGA
XQ6SLX150T-3CSG484I IC FPGA SPARTAN-6Q 484-CSBGA
相關(guān)代理商/技術(shù)參數(shù)
參數(shù)描述
XE88LC01 制造商:未知廠家 制造商全稱:未知廠家 功能描述:Sensing Machine 16 + 10 bit Data Acquisition Ultra Low-Power Microcontroller
XE88LC01MI000 制造商:未知廠家 制造商全稱:未知廠家 功能描述:Sensing Machine 16 + 10 bit Data Acquisition Ultra Low-Power Microcontroller
XE88LC01MI027 制造商:未知廠家 制造商全稱:未知廠家 功能描述:Sensing Machine 16 + 10 bit Data Acquisition Ultra Low-Power Microcontroller
XE88LC01MI032 制造商:未知廠家 制造商全稱:未知廠家 功能描述:Sensing Machine 16 + 10 bit Data Acquisition Ultra Low-Power Microcontroller
XE88LC01RI000 制造商:未知廠家 制造商全稱:未知廠家 功能描述:Sensing Machine 16 + 10 bit Data Acquisition Ultra Low-Power Microcontroller